Antica Dimora Navona Apartment - Rome
41.89784, 12.47197Antica Dimora Navona Apartment is located within 500 metres of Church of Saint Louis the French and overlooks the city. In order to explore the local area, this apartment provides rental cars.
Location
The aqueduct-fed rococo Trevi Fountain is at a distance of only 1.2 km away, while the late Renaissance church "St. Peter's Basilica" is only 1.9 km away. A 25-minute walk will take you to the city centre. The 130 m² Antica Dimora Navona Apartment is also nearly 25 minutes on foot from Colosseum Arena.
This property is within easy reach of Rinascimento bus stop.
Rooms
Furnished with a sofa set and a work desk, the interior features sound-proofed windows. In-room amenities encompass ironing facilities and air conditioning, as well as a TV set with satellite channels for guests' convenience. Bathroom facilities include a bidet, a bathtub, and a separate toilet. Hairdryers, dressing gowns, and shower caps can also be found.
Eat & Drink
This 2-bedroom apartment offers a fully furnished kitchen with a microwave oven, a refrigerator, and kitchenware, along with tea/coffee making equipment.

Lovely apartment. Our Rome home base for 10 wonderful days! The location really can't be beat -- right behind the Piazza Navona! We were a party of three women, and this was our third time to Rome together, so we already knew this area well. The apartment is very centrally located and off a great street lined with restaurants, cafes, small shops, etc. You're a stones throw away from the Campo de Fiori and the Pantheon is close by as well. The apartment is within walking distance to many of the famous sites. It does have a lift up to the first floor, but we only used it for our luggage. We were very happy with the size of the apartment and we each had our own rooms, using the living room as the third bedroom with its sofa bed. There are two full bathrooms with showers. The owners, Max and Tina, were incredibly helpful and responded to our questions right away. They also had wine, water, and treats waiting for us upon arrival! A really nice and welcoming touch! we were quite pleased with the property and would recommend.
